GHS sends 15 wrestlers to state

Fifteen Gilmer High School wrestlers are heading to state. The final stage of the boys state qualifying process was at last Saturday’s Class 3A B Sectional in Gainesville. Teams from four regions were in attendance, and a top eight placement was necessary for state qualification.

Lady Cats lock up No. 2 seed, state berth

The Gilmer High Lady Cats closed out the regular season with two more region basketball wins. And with that comes a No. 2 seed heading into the region tournament, which guarantees the Cats a state spot. GHS began last week at home Tuesday when the Heritage Generals (19-6 overall)  came to town.

Gilmer wrestling wins region

The Gilmer Bobcats’ stellar wrestling season rolled on with a traditional region championship. The Bobcats were in LaFayette last Saturday for the seven-team event, and not much stood between the top three teams. Gilmer ended its day with 215.

GHS girls are region runners-up

Eight Gilmer High girls will continue their wrestling seasons. GHS was in Dahlonega last Friday for the 29-team Area 6 traditional tournament. Gilmer’s Sarai Solis stood above all among 110 pounders. In the team standings, Gilmer ended its day second to Lumpkin County, 224-185.

Strong second half leads to GHS Bobcats’ victory

The Gilmer Bobcats earned a road win over the Murray County Indians. GHS was in Chastworth last Friday for the nonregion matchup, and the Indians held an edge through three quarters. However, Gilmer came on strong in the fourth and erased the Indians’ lead to earn a 64-55 win.
